The Beauty of Fat Augmentation
Fat augmentation, also known as fat transfer or fat grafting, is a cosmetic procedure that involves removing fat from one part of your body and transferring it to another. It's a versatile technique that can enhance various features, including the face, breasts, buttocks, and hands. Here are ten key points to consider:

3. Natural Breast Augmentation
For those seeking breast enhancement without implants, fat augmentation offers a natural alternative. It can increase the size and improve the shape of the breasts using your own fat cells.
Your surgeon will carefully harvest fat from areas such as the abdomen or thighs and inject it into the breasts. This technique not only adds volume but also improves breast symmetry, resulting in a more proportionate and youthful bustline.
4. Shapely Buttocks with Fat Transfer
If you desire a more curvaceous figure, fat augmentation can be utilized to enhance the buttocks. The popular Brazilian Butt Lift (BBL) procedure uses fat transfer to create rounder, fuller buttocks with a more defined shape.
During the procedure, excess fat is removed from areas of the body where it's unwanted, such as the abdomen or hips, and transferred to the buttocks. This gives your rear end a natural lift, improves its projection, and creates a more aesthetically pleasing silhouette.
5. Rejuvenating Aging Hands
As we age, the volume in our hands diminishes, causing them to appear bony and veiny. Fat augmentation can help restore a more youthful look to your hands by replacing lost volume and softening the appearance of wrinkles.
By carefully injecting fat into the back of your hands, your surgeon can plump them up and provide a smoother skin texture. This procedure can help your hands regain a more youthful and vibrant appearance that matches your rejuvenated face.
6. Minimally Invasive and Short Recovery
Fat augmentation is considered a minimally invasive procedure, often performed on an outpatient basis. Although the length of the procedure depends on the extent of augmentation desired, it generally takes a few hours to complete.
Recovery time is typically shorter compared to more invasive surgeries. Most patients can resume normal activities within a week, although strenuous exercise and heavy lifting should be avoided for several weeks.

8. Addressing Concerns with Liposuction
Fat augmentation often involves liposuction as the first step. This allows your surgeon to remove excess fat from areas such as the abdomen, thighs, or hips. Liposuction helps contour the body and harvest the fat cells for transfer.
If you have areas of unwanted fat that you'd like to address, fat augmentation can provide the added benefit of body sculpting by redistributing the fat cells collected through liposuction.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q: How long do the results of fat augmentation last?
A: The results of fat augmentation can last several years, with around 60-80% of the transferred fat cells surviving in the long term.
Q: Are there any risks associated with fat augmentation?
A: As with any surgical procedure, there are risks involved, such as infection, bleeding, and changes in sensation. However, when performed by a qualified surgeon, fat augmentation is generally considered safe.
Q: How much does fat augmentation cost?
A: The cost of fat augmentation varies depending on factors such as the extent of augmentation, the areas being treated, and the experience of the surgeon. It's best to consult with your surgeon for an accurate cost estimate.
Q: Can I exercise after fat augmentation?
A: While light activities can be resumed within a few days, it's important to avoid strenuous exercise and heavy lifting for several weeks to allow for proper healing.
Q: Will fat augmentation leave visible scars?
A: The incisions made for liposuction and fat transfer are typically small and strategically placed, resulting in minimal scarring that is easily hidden.
